The Centerpiece of the Celebration: Show-Stopping Vegan Main Courses
The heart of any holiday meal lies in its main course, and for a vegan feast, this means finding dishes that are both hearty and visually impressive. The collection offers a diverse range of options, catering to various taste preferences and culinary ambitions.

One standout is the Vegan Seitan Steak, a testament to the power of plant-based ingenuity. This recipe promises a juicy and remarkably easy-to-make seitan that avoids the toughness often associated with store-bought alternatives. By incorporating sparkling water and canned chickpeas, the seitan achieves a tender texture that pairs exquisitely with roasted potatoes and a rich herb butter. The ease of preparation, with ingredients combined in a food processor and no kneading required, makes it an accessible yet sophisticated choice for busy holiday cooks.

For those who appreciate the elegance of seasonal produce, Couscous-Stuffed Acorn Squash presents a beautiful and flavorful option. This dish, featuring a medley of couscous, smoked tofu, and mushrooms, offers a delightful balance of textures and savory notes. Served alongside a homemade cranberry sauce, it transforms the humble acorn squash into a truly festive centerpiece. A variation on this theme, the Couscous Stuffed Butternut Squash Boat, offers a Mediterranean twist, infusing the dish with vibrant flavors and presenting it in an equally appealing format.

For a more traditional "roast" experience, the Lentil Roast with Balsamic Onion Gravy from Wallflower Kitchen is a prime contender. This hearty lentil loaf, often paired with a rich, savory gravy, provides a comforting and satisfying alternative to meat-based roasts. Similarly, the Smoky Southern-Style Meatless Meatloaf by Veganosity, crafted with black beans and chickpeas and boasting a spicy homemade BBQ sauce, promises to win over even the most devoted meat-eaters with its robust flavor profile.

For a lighter yet equally impactful option, the Vegan Potato & Spinach Strudel offers a flaky, savory pastry filled with the comforting combination of potatoes and spinach. It’s presented as an ideal easy lunch or dinner, and the suggested cilantro lemon dip elevates it further.

A more unique offering, the Seitan Roast with Bread Stuffing, directly addresses the desire for a classic roast dinner experience, reimagined for a vegan table. This recipe ensures that no one has to miss out on the tradition of a stuffed roast, offering a delightful surprise for guests.

Finally, for a dish that combines elegance with accessible ingredients, Fried Polenta Stacks with Squash and Cashew Cream by Cadry’s Kitchen offers a visually stunning and flavorful alternative. The layers of fried polenta, sweet BBQ squash, and creamy cashew sauce create a harmonious blend of tastes and textures that is sure to impress.

The Supporting Cast: Irresistible Vegan Side Dishes
No holiday meal is complete without a vibrant array of side dishes, and this collection offers a wealth of plant-based options to complement any main course. These sides are designed to be both comforting and celebratory, incorporating seasonal flavors and classic holiday staples.

Potatoes, a perennial holiday favorite, are celebrated in several delicious vegan iterations. The Vegan Potato Croquettes promise a delightful contrast of crispy exterior and creamy interior, making them an irresistible addition to any festive spread. For a smoother, more classic comfort, Vegan Mashed Potatoes with caramelized onions and garlic offer an elevated take on a beloved dish, infusing it with layers of savory flavor.

Brussels sprouts, a much-loved (and sometimes debated) holiday vegetable, are given a plant-based makeover with several enticing recipes. Pan-Roasted Brussels Sprouts in Soy Sauce offer a simple yet profoundly flavorful preparation, with the soy sauce adding a savory depth. For those who enjoy a touch of sweetness and acidity, Maple Balsamic Brussels Sprouts with hazelnuts and rosemary provide a sophisticated flavor profile. And for the ultimate indulgence, Crispy Fried Brussels Sprouts with Sriracha Mayo offer a delightful textural contrast and a hint of spice.

The sweetness of root vegetables is also a hallmark of holiday meals, and this collection delivers. Molasses, Miso and Maple Candied Vegan Sweet Potatoes offer a unique and complex flavor profile, blending the deep sweetness of molasses and maple with the umami of miso for a truly memorable side. Roasted Yams with Lime Sunflower Seed Sauce present a vibrant and refreshing alternative, while simple yet delicious Oven-Baked Sweet Potato Slices and Oven Baked Potato Slices offer versatile options that can be enjoyed as a side or a snack.

For those seeking color and texture, Smashed Purple Potatoes add a visually stunning element to the table, offering a simple yet elegant preparation. The Braised Red Cabbage provides a beautiful, deep hue and a tender, slightly sweet and tangy flavor that is a classic accompaniment to holiday roasts.

Grain-based sides also feature prominently, offering wholesome and flavorful options. Tri-Color Quinoa with walnuts and cranberries brings a festive touch with its colorful grains and the classic holiday pairing of nuts and dried fruit. For a hearty and versatile option, the Vegan Thanksgiving Power Bowl offers a customizable arrangement of typical Thanksgiving flavors, ensuring a satisfying and nutritious addition to the meal.

Carrots, a naturally sweet and vibrant vegetable, are elevated in the Easy Maple Roasted Carrots recipe, which offers a delightful balance of sweet and savory with an optional creamy lemon sauce for added flair.

Rounding out the side dish selection are comforting and familiar favorites. The Vegan Green Bean Casserole from Fried Dandelions promises to evoke nostalgic holiday memories with its classic flavors. For a unique and satisfying carb option, Pan-Fried Bread Dumplings offer a quick and crispy alternative to traditional dumplings, perfect for soaking up rich gravies and stews. And for those who crave freshly baked bread, Easy Homemade Garlic Knots by Cook with Kushi provide irresistible, flavor-packed bites.

The Essential Finishing Touches: Flavorful Vegan Sauces
No holiday meal is truly complete without the perfect sauces to tie all the elements together. This collection includes two essential vegan sauces that will elevate any festive dish.

The Easy 3-Ingredient Cranberry Sauce is a testament to simplicity and tradition. Made from scratch with fresh cranberries, this quick and effortless recipe provides the quintessential sweet and tart accompaniment to Thanksgiving and Christmas dinners.

For a richer, more savory accompaniment, the Vegan Peppercorn Sauce offers a quick and easy solution. Made with staple ingredients, this sauce is designed to impress and add a luxurious finishing touch to vegan roasts and sides, ensuring that no dish is left wanting for depth of flavor.
